About The Position

This is an Operations position responsible for overseeing the safe operation, daily monitoring, and maintenance activities associated with Material Handling Equipment (MHE), and maintenance of industrial batteries. The role involves performing moderate supervisory duties when higher-level management is unavailable, mentoring junior technicians, and ensuring the fleet's availability for operations teams. The position requires strong decision-making skills, clear communication, and adherence to all safety policies and procedures. The technician will be proficient in electrical meter testing, knowledgeable in controls and various electrical systems (AC/DC low voltage), and skilled in troubleshooting PLCs, motors, motor starters, contactors, and relays. Responsibilities include completing electrical repairs, welding projects, and performing preventive maintenance on power MHE, including fluid checks, belt/chain adjustments, electrical control troubleshooting, and motor/control replacements. The role also requires knowledge of hydraulic and mechanical systems, assisting battery technicians with charger repairs, battery changes, and maintenance, participating in an on-call program, and logging all time and materials into the CMMS. Housekeeping of maintenance areas, tool maintenance, adherence to safety requirements, and responding to emergencies are also key aspects of the job. The technician will champion safety, comply with regulations, and interact effectively with colleagues.
